DEADLINE: EJN Western Balkans Environmental Media Grant [20]

Internews’ Earth Journalism Network is offering one grant of 10,000 euros to a journalist network, media organization, civil society organization or academic institution in the Western Balkans to support activities that improve media coverage of environmental challenges and solutions. Deadline: Oct 30, 2025.

"Jane Goodall, Legendary Primatologist, Has Died At Age 91" [24]

"Jane Goodall, a scientist whose studies of wild chimpanzees made her a household name, has died at the age of 91, according to an announcement posted by the Jane Goodall Institute."

As Trump Cuts NSF By 56 Percent, Arctic Research Center Closes Its Doors [46]

"After nearly 40 years, the Arctic Research Consortium of the United States, or ARCUS, will close September 30, a casualty of President Donald Trump’s proposed budget cuts and his administration’s focus on using the Arctic as an outpost for national security and energy dominance — and its push away from science."

"World’s Major Cities Hit By 25% Leap In Extremely Hot Days Since The 1990s" [49]

"The world’s biggest capital cities are now sweltering under 25% more extremely hot days each year than in the 1990s, an analysis has found. Without urgent action to protect millions of people from high temperatures, more and more will suffer in the dangerous conditions, analysts said."
